Responsibilities for Physiotherapy Assistant Jobs:
- Patient Support: Providing patients with therapeutic exercises and mobility training.
- Equipment Setup: The process of preparing and maintaining physiotherapy equipment.
- Treatment Assistance: Assisting physiotherapists in the administration of treatments such as electrical stimulation and heat/cold therapy.
- Record-Keeping: The process of updating medical records and documenting patient progress.
- Education and Guidance: Providing patients with guidance on safe movement techniques and domestic exercises.
- Clinic Maintenance: Guaranteeing a treatment environment that is both tidy and organised.
- Patient Monitoring: The act of observing and reporting changes in the condition of a patient to the physiotherapist.

Can I work as a physiotherapist assistant in Canada?
Physiotherapy assistants require completion of a two-year physical therapy assistant (PTA) college program or a two-year rehabilitation therapy assistant program, as well as supervised practical training. Occupational therapy assistants must complete a two-year occupational therapy assistant (OTA) college program.
